Advancements in battery and inverter technology have led major string inverter manufacturers, such as Fronius and Huawei, to incorporate battery integration as a standard feature, effectively transforming their string inverters into hybrid inverters. A solar inverter converts the DC electricity generated by photovoltaic (PV) panels into AC power compatible with the electrical grid or local consumption. It's a vital Balance of System (BOS) component and includes functions like Maximum Power Point Tracking (MPPT) and anti‑islanding protection. The 600kW three-phase inverter demonstrates system-level power density and efficiency obtained by using by using six of Wolfspeed's XM3 half-bridge power modules. With half the weight and volume of a standard 62mm module; the XM3 footprint maximizes power density while minimizing loop inductance. In a collaborative project between the Fraunhofer Institute IZM, Porsche, and Bosch, the Continuous Power inverter has been designed, which, thanks to the capabilities of SiC transistors and 3D printing, provides 600 kW of continuous power while remaining thermally stable.

A solar inverter or photovoltaic (PV) inverter is a type of power inverter which converts the variable direct current (DC) output of a photovoltaic solar panel into a utility frequency alternating current (AC) that can be fed into a commercial electrical grid or used by a local, off-grid electrical.     The objective of the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) project is to support Kosovo's energy security and transition to a more sustainable energy future through usage of energy storage systems for reserves, availability of the storage systems, and reduced cost of securing adequate electricity for Kosovo.

    What are the power plants in Kosovo?

    The greatest part of generation capacities of Kosovo are the two power plants: Kosova A and Kosova B. The capacities of the two power plants are lower than the installation parameters level, because of the outdated system and lack of maintenance during the last decade of the 20th century.
